Buying Property in Türkiye as a Foreigner

Türkiye remains one of the most accessible major property markets for foreign buyers, with a purchase process that can be completed in weeks once a property is selected. Most nationalities can buy freely, subject to certain zone-based restrictions.

The core steps are: property selection, an independent valuation, a sales contract, tax-number registration, payment through the banking system with a currency-exchange certificate, and transfer of the title deed (Tapu) at the Land Registry.

Costs to budget for include the title-deed transfer tax, notary and translation fees, valuation report and, for new builds, utility connection charges.
